Transaction 5c3158b7487fad2fa9237ed0e20f6ebef0a7b520bd5ba2bc30fc0ae29b597735
1 Input
1 Output
-
5c3158b7487fad2fa9237ed0e20f6ebef0a7b520bd5ba2bc30fc0ae29b597735:0
- value
- 37820
- script pubkey
- OP_0 OP_PUSHBYTES_20 8b8107843693525ae8c6eb03445f3432987a2cb6
- address
- bc1q3wqs0ppkjdf946xxavp5ghe5x2v85t9ku35ur2